MINI Parks Its Go-Kart Charm in Surat as BMW Group Expands Gujarat Footprint

Surat’s luxury car scene just got a little more “mini” — and that’s actually a big deal. BMW Group India has officially appointed Eminent Cars as the new dealer partner for MINI in Surat, Gujarat, bringing the iconic British-born premium hatchback brand closer to one of India’s fastest-growing luxury markets.

The move strengthens MINI’s presence in West India and signals BMW Group India’s continued push to make premium mobility more accessible in emerging luxury hubs. And honestly, in a city known for diamonds, designer lifestyles and fast-growing aspirations, MINI’s quirky personality feels right at home.

Hardeep Singh Brar, President and CEO of BMW Group India, said the launch of MINI in Surat marks an important milestone for the company’s expansion strategy in entrepreneurial and rapidly evolving markets. According to him, Gujarat’s growing appetite for premium lifestyle brands and unique experiences makes it a natural fit for MINI’s unconventional character and urban mobility appeal.

Brar added that together with Eminent Cars, BMW Group India is creating an integrated Retail.NEXT destination that combines immersive design, digital innovation and highly personalised customer engagement under one roof. In simpler words, it’s not just a car showroom anymore — it’s becoming a luxury lounge where your coffee might arrive before your financing options.

The new Retail.Next dealership on Dumas Road in Surat spans 7,500 sq ft and showcases both BMW and MINI models together. The ultra-modern facility can display up to seven vehicles and has been designed to deliver a highly interactive retail experience. Customers can explore vehicles in a living-room-inspired environment with cozy seating areas placed close to the cars, making the experience feel less “dealership pressure” and more “premium lifestyle hangout.”

Ankur Jain, Dealer Principal of Eminent Cars, said Surat has emerged as one of Gujarat’s most progressive luxury markets with customers who appreciate innovation, style and individuality. He noted that MINI’s iconic design language, fun-to-drive nature and expressive personality perfectly match the city’s energetic spirit.

Beyond the showroom glamour, the service infrastructure is equally serious. The dealership’s workshop stretches across 13,100 sq ft and includes 10 mechanical bays along with seven body and paint bays to ensure comprehensive aftersales support. BMW Group India says the facility is equipped with state-of-the-art technology to maintain high standards across sales, service and business operations.

The Retail.NEXT concept also introduces several modern customer-focused features. BMW Geniuses armed with digital sales tools will assist customers with detailed product consultations, while dedicated Sales Consultancy Lounges offer private spaces for discussions related to financing and leasing. The Multifunctional Handover Bay adds a premium touch to vehicle deliveries and test drives, ensuring customers remember the experience long after the new-car smell fades.

The showroom also features a lifestyle and accessories zone showcasing the latest BMW and MINI merchandise, because apparently owning the car is only the beginning of the brand relationship.

In line with BMW Group’s growing electrification push, the dealership is also equipped with EV charging infrastructure for Battery Electric Vehicle users. The Retail.Next format further integrates lighting, sound, temperature and décor to create a more immersive luxury experience — proving that even the showroom now comes with its own “drive mode.”

With Surat joining MINI’s India network, the brand is clearly betting that Indian luxury buyers increasingly want something more expressive, youthful and fun than the traditional executive sedan. And if the city’s vibrant energy is any indication, MINI may just find plenty of people ready to swap predictable luxury for something with a little more personality — and a lot more cheekiness.
